Summary
There are moments in our walk with God when the light seems to fade. We stumble, not because the presence of God has left us, but because something has come between us and the Light.
In this week’s Monday Meditations, we explore the quiet eclipse — the subtle ways fear, shame, and failure drift between our hearts and the face of Christ. Like Peter in the courtyard or David on the rooftop, we sometimes forget the light we’ve seen in times when shadows fall.
But the light has not gone out. It is only hidden for a moment — and even there, God is praying, restoring, and calling us back.
If you’ve felt distant, overwhelmed, or unworthy — this episode is for you. Let’s rediscover the true Light that never stops shining, even in the valley of shadow.
